ipv6 pimdm
Use the ipv6 pimdm command to enable PIM-DM Multicast Routing Mode across the router in
global configuration mode or on a specific routing interface in interface mode. Use the "no"
form of this command to disable PIM-DM.
Syntax
ipv6 pimdm
no ipv6 pimdm
Default Configuration
IPv6 PIM-DM is disabled by default.
Command Mode
Global Configuration mode
Interface Configuration (VLAN) mode
User Guidelines
There are no user guidelines for this command.
Example
console(config-if-vlan3)#ipv6 pimdm
ipv6 pimdm hello-interval
The ipv6 pimdm hello-interval command is used to configure the PIM-DM Hello Interval for
the specified router interface. The Hello-interval is to be specified in seconds. Use the "no"
form of this command to reset the hello interval to the default.
Syntax
interval
ipv6 pimdm hello-interval
no ipv6 pimdm hello-interval
•
interval - The hello interval time in seconds (Range: 0–65535).
Default Configuration
The default hello interval is 30 seconds.
Command Mode
Interface Configuration (VLAN) mode
